SOOP will participate in the 2026 Korea Creator Festa, held at COEX Magok in Seoul from August 28 to 29, featuring on-site content with streamers and users.
The 2026 Korea Creator Festa is an event that introduces content and technology from creators and the media industry while offering networking opportunities and interactive programs for creators, visitors, and companies. SOOP has participated in the event every year since 2020.
At this event, SOOP is expanding mukbang and cookbang—staple live streaming content—into offline experiences. The platform plans to run programs where streamers prepare food directly on-site and enjoy it together with attendees.
On August 28, starting at 12:00 PM, streamer “Ilhaneun Yonghyung”—a former Chinese cuisine chef—and guest “Yueun” will host a food truck cookbang. Created based on “Yong Sikdang,” a cooking studio jointly operated by SOOP and Ilhaneun Yonghyung, they will prepare on-site “Soopbul Cold Jjamppong,” a summer reinterpretation of their signature “Soopbul Jjamppong” dish.
On August 29, streamer “Yuchittang” and special guest “Gyeowoodi” will prepare street food items, including tteokbokki and fish cakes. The prepared menu will be provided to attendees free of charge.
From 11:00 AM to 1:00 PM on both days of the event, the “SOOP Event” will take place, allowing visitors to participate and win prizes. From 1:00 PM to 3:00 PM, popular streamers will run “SOOP Explorers,” introducing food options and interactive programs across the venue while delivering live broadcasts of the scene. From 3:00 PM to 5:00 PM, a tarot reading session with streamer “Yakganparah” will follow.
During the event, a “Creator Welcome Consultation Zone” will also be operated for prospective streamers looking to begin broadcasting on SOOP. Company staff will offer one-on-one consultations to guide them through essential information for streaming, including account registration and technical support.
